Judith Charlton is a scholar working on Applied Microbiology and Biotechnology, Surgery and Epidemiology. According to data from OpenAlex, Judith Charlton has authored 42 papers receiving a total of 2.1k ind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 12 papers in Applied Microbiology and Biotechnology, 11 papers in Surgery and 9 papers in Epidemiology. Recurrent topics in Judith Charlton’s work include Antibiotic Use and Resistance (12 papers), Healthcare Systems and Technology (9 papers) and Patient Satisfaction in Healthcare (8 papers). Judith Charlton is often cited by papers focused on Antibiotic Use and Resistance (12 papers), Healthcare Systems and Technology (9 papers) and Patient Satisfaction in Healthcare (8 papers). Judith Charlton collaborates with scholars based in United Kingdom, Qatar and United States. Judith Charlton's co-authors include Martin Gulliford, Radoslav Latinovic, Mark Ashworth, Alex Dregan, Roger Jones, Caroline Rudisill, Nawaraj Bhattarai, A Toby Prevost, Paul Little and Michael Moore and has published in prestigious journals such as Notes and Queries, PLoS ONE and Diabetes Care.
